C2C Advanced Systems Limited has received an order from Hindustan Shipyard Limited for the supply of Warship Electronic Chart Display and Information Systems (WECDIS) for fleet support ships being constructed for the Indian Navy.
The Fleet Support Ship programme is a logistics-focused initiative of the Indian Navy aimed at enhancing the operational endurance of naval task forces.
The Company had been previously nominated as a vendor for WECDIS systems by the Indian Navy following successful installation, integration and trial processes on operational naval platforms, as disclosed in the Company’s announcement dated 5th August 2025. This nomination enables participation in both new shipbuilding programmes and retrofit opportunities across the existing fleet.
The present order represents deployment of the Company’s systems on new-build platforms under the Fleet Support Ship programme.
Naval vessels typically operate over long service lifecycles, during which onboard electronic and navigation systems undergo periodic upgrades and replacements. As a result, systems such as WECDIS form part of both initial shipbuilding requirements and long-term modernisation programmes.
While the company has not disclosed the order value, they are estimating an opportunity in the range of approximately ₹1.6-1.8 billion over 3 years, according to the exchange filing.
WECDIS systems are aligned with Indian Naval standards and operational protocols. The system performs a range of mission-critical functions onboard naval vessels, including:
- Real-time ship positioning through integration with GPS and inertial navigation systems
- Route planning with awareness of depth, navigational hazards and restricted zones
- Dynamic re-routing capabilities during operational missions
- Fusion of inputs from multiple onboard systems, including navigation sensors, surveillance systems and interfaced combat systems
- Generation of a Common Operational Picture (COP) for use across the bridge and Combat Information Centre
WECDIS is a military-grade navigation and situational awareness system designed specifically for naval operations. It is an advanced variant of the commercial Electronic Chart Display and Information System (ECDIS).
While ECDIS is primarily used for merchant navigation, WECDIS extends functionality to support naval operations and tactical decision-making.
